Territory Manager - ParkPlace

ParkPlace has a culture built around sacrifice, synergy, and where no single person is larger than holding a sign to help a car park.

We are currently looking for a Territory Manager who can lead a team of Sales Professionals. The pay is $40,000-$60,000 per year. We are quickly expanding and have teams stationed across the U.S., but you would be in charge of hiring and leading a team within Texas.

As a Territory Manager, you would have the opportunity to make an impactful difference for communities of homeowners, commercial lots owners, etc. by helping them make the most of the land that they own.

Territory Manager Job Responsibilities:

  • Lead generation, Sales, and Onboarding of clients
  • Adjusts content of sales presentations to prospective clients by understanding and analyzing their pain points
  • Immerses themselves in the existing parking ecosystem
  • Assesses markets to determine which ParkPlace solution to deploy
  • Reports call logs, strategic plans, results, and event analysis on an agreed-upon timeline
  • Collects data on existing parking inventory, consumer behavior, and unique market characteristics
  • Resolves customer qualms through investigation, strategic deployment of solutions, measuring results and reporting subsequent steps
  • Maintains professional and technical knowledge by attending educational workshops, reviewing professional publications, establishing networks, and participating in related community events
  • Outreach for lead generation from referrals and other creative methods
  • Provides organized record management on the ParkPlace CRM
